A Day in the Life at Manoogian Manor

Photo showing seven different Manoogian Manor residents.

What’s it really like to live at Manoogian Manor? While every resident’s experience is unique, there’s a shared rhythm of care, activity, and connection that makes each day meaningful. Here’s a glimpse into what residents enjoy on a typical day in our community.

A Typical Day at Manoogian Manor:

  1. Morning Wellness and Breakfast
    Residents begin their day with a gentle wake-up, medication support if needed, and a warm, made-to-order breakfast served in the dining room.
  2. Mid-Morning Activities
    From chair yoga to creative writing, this is a time for movement and stimulation. Residents choose what interests them most.
  3. Personal Time and Socializing
    Some enjoy a stroll through the garden, others read the newspaper or chat with friends in the lounge. This is a relaxed time tailored to personal routines.
  4. Lunch and Conversation
    A balanced, flavorful lunch is served restaurant-style, with opportunities to dine with friends or family guests.
  5. Afternoon Enrichment
    The afternoon may include music therapy, guest speakers, art projects, or movie screenings. Residents often join favorite weekly clubs.
  6. Visits and Family Time
    Many families stop by after work or school to visit, creating multigenerational connections and memories.
  7. Dinner and Evening Reflection
    Dinner is cozy and comforting, followed by low-key activities like puzzles, quiet music, or group discussions.
  8. Nighttime Care and Rest
    Staff assist with bedtime routines, ensure safety checks, and provide a peaceful environment for a good night’s sleep.
